Poultry lawsuit still sound, Edmondson spokesman says

Posted: August 5, 2009 at 7:44 a.m.

Setbacks for Oklahoma Attorney General Drew Edmondson in his federal lawsuit against poultry companies operating in Arkansas have done nothing to restart long-stalled settlement negotiations.
